Madison Peach

Medium size, bright red freestone fruit. High quality, slightly fibrous, firm, orange-yellow flesh with contrasting pinkish red near the pit. Mild, rich flavor. Flesh is slow to soften. Skin peels easily. Excellent canning peach. Tree is hardy, vigorous, frost resistant and self pollinating. Blossom buds have considerable resistance to spring frosts. Recommended for Northern climates. Ripens in late August, 7 days before Elberta. 850 chill hours, Zones 5-8. Introduced in 1963 by the Virginia Ag. Station.
